Title XXVII RAILROADS AND OTHER REGULATED UTILITIESChapter 361 PUBLIC UTILITIES: SPECIAL POWERS361.15 Issuance of bonds.--For the purpose of financing or refinancing the cost of a project or projects, any municipality, authority, board, commission, or other public body which is an electric utility as defined in this act and is a participant in a project under this act may exercise all the powers in connection with the authorization, issuance, and sale of bonds as the same are conferred upon municipalities by part I of chapter 159. All of the privileges, benefits, powers, and terms of part I of chapter 159 shall be fully applicable to such body. For the purpose of this section, a project as defined in this part shall be a project within the definition of the term "project" in s. 159.02(4). History.--s. 6, ch. 75-200.
